Undergraduate Tuition & Fees
The following table compares 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ees between selected colleges. The average undergraduate tuition & fees is $5,040 for in-state students and $8,850 for out-of-state students. The 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ees of selected colleges are increased by 1.84% compared to the previous year.
Among the selected colleges, J. F. Drake State Community and Technical College requires the most expensive tuition & fees of $8,940 and Northeast Alabama Community College has the lowest tuition & fees of $8,790 for undergraduate programs.
Name | 2022-2023 | 2023-2024 | ||
---|---|---|---|---|
In-State | Out-of-State | In-State | Out-of-State | |
Northeast Alabama Community College | $4,920 | $8,670 | $4,980 | $8,790 |
Northwest-Shoals Community College | $5,011 | $8,761 | $5,071 | $8,881 |
Lawson State Community College | $4,920 | $8,670 | $4,980 | $8,790 |
J. F. Drake State Community and Technical College | $4,890 | $8,640 | $5,130 | $8,940 |
Enterprise State Community College | $4,920 | $8,670 | $5,040 | $8,850 |
Chattahoochee Valley Community College | $4,980 | $8,730 | $5,040 | $8,850 |
Average | $4,940 | $8,690 | $5,040 | $8,850 |
